Summary

  • YPulse says Gen Z is moving beyond a TikTok fad, taking up traditional “granny hobbies” and buying vintage tech as part of a broader push to unplug.
  • The shift is tied to frustration with always-on digital life, with the trend report framing analog activities and older devices as a way to disconnect.
  • Gen Z girls are especially active in hands-on hobbies, while Gen Z boys are showing a parallel analog streak through collecting rather than knitting or crafting.
  • The finding, highlighted in YPulse’s July 9, 2026 Going Analog Trend Report, points to a wider youth preference for offline, tactile experiences.
